I'm pulling out an AM/FM/CD changer/premium radio out of an 05 Tribute in order to install an aftermarket double din radio with built in navigation. It has an ISO port in the back of the new radio and comes with an ISO pigtail harness. I can wire in the included harness but I'd rather not cut up the original harness in case I sell the Tribute and want to reinstall the original radio back into it.

So.. is there an ISO to Mazda harness that will allow an ISO equipped radio to plug and play into the Tribute without splicing?
